Prysmian S.p.A. Overview
Pro stress-test →Prysmian is the world leader in cable manufacturer specializing in energy solutions and telecom cables and systems. The company produces, distributes, and sells power and telecom cables and systems, and related accessories under the Prysmian, Draka, and General Cable brands worldwide. The company is positioned as a major beneficiary of global energy transition and digital infrastructure trends.
Strategic Profile
Pro stress-test →Prysmian leads in high-voltage cables and benefits from global electrification and energy transition trends, with 65% of its business tied to these themes. The company is the world leader in the production of cables for wind farms. CEO Massimo Bataini called Q3 2025 'the best quarter ever,' emphasizing innovation as 'our key driver of profitability and volume and share enhancement.'
Competitive Landscape
Pro stress-test →Prysmian is twice as large as its second main competitor, with a market dominated by approximately ten competitors globally across Italy, the US and China. The company faces competition from traditional cable manufacturers but maintains distinct advantages in high-voltage systems and renewable energy infrastructure.
